How To Colour Coordinate Shirt With Pant?

Men fashion tips to colour coordinate shirts:
White: A white shirt can go with any coloured trousers or jeans. To make the best use of this spring colour, team up your classic white shirt with a dark trouser. For a casual look, you can team up a white shirt with denims and sneakers.
Gray: A man's wardrobe will always have a gray shirt or t-shirt. You can team up this classic colour with bright coloured pants. Go for black pants to carry the stylish look. Avoid wearing colourful pants. Gray is an elegant colour which can look funny if teamed up with a coloured pant.
Black: This stylish colour is easy to coordinate. Men can look fashionable by smartly colour coordinating their black shirts. As it is a dark colour, any light coloured pant will compliment the bold look of the black shirt. You can wear a black shirt with a light coloured trouser or jeans. Prefer shoes over sneakers for an informal look! It adds spark to the stylish bold colour.
These are the basic men fashion tips to colour coordinate shirts. Remember, light coloured shirts should be teamed up with dark pants and vice versa.
